Charged Higgs: Interpretation of -physics results

Abstract

In these proceedings we review the impact of additional Higgs bosons on physics observables. For this purpose, we consider first the 2HDM of type II which respects natural flavour conservation. Afterwards, we study a 2HDM with generic flavour structure (of type III). While constraints from impose stringent bounds on non-minimal flavour violation in the down sector, can also constrain flavour violation in the up sector. Despite these stringent constraints and the recent CMS bounds from it is shown that still large effects in tauonic decays are possible, such that the BABAR measurements of these decays can be explained. The matching of the Yukawa sector of the MSSM on the 2HDM is discussed.
